
The dominant force in women’s motocross, Kiara Fontanesi left it to her home round of Imola to secure a sixth WMX World Title, and her fifth on Dunlop Geomax tyres.
After going 2-1 at Imola, Fontanesi was crowned the overall Grand Prix winner at the final event of the season, securing her latest title in a nail biting finale.
In the FIM Motocross World Championship, Dunlop recorded five finishers in the top-ten in Italy, with Clement Desalle’s podium confirming his third place in the championship. Julien Lieber (Kawasaki) took fourth in the MXGP of Italy, with Shaun Simpson (Yamaha), Jeremy Seewer (Yamaha) and Evgeny Bobryshev (Suzuki) finishing seventh, eighth and tenth respectively for the tyre maker.

All of Dunlop’s riders chose the new Geomax MX33 for the hard-pack track in Italy.
